Order items from most general to most specific
Free printable Grade 4 English worksheet for "Order items from most general to most specific" — practice organizing writing (writing strategies). No-prep, print or assign online.
This worksheet helps students practice ordering items from the most general to the most specific, a key skill in organizing writing. Teachers can use it to reinforce writing strategies that enhance clarity and logical flow. It supports developing critical thinking by encouraging students to categorize and sequence ideas effectively.
Learning objectives
- Identify general and specific items within a list.
- Arrange items from the most general to the most specific accurately.
- Demonstrate understanding of organizing ideas to improve writing clarity.
